2004 Chevrolet TrailBlazer Ext Specifications
| Spec | Value |
|---|---|
| Combined MPG | 15–16 combined MPG depending on trim |
| City MPG | 14 |
| Highway MPG | 19 |
| Body Style | SUV |
| Fuel Type | Regular |
| Drive | AWD/4WD |
| Available Trims | 4 |
Available Trims
| Trim | MPG (City/Hwy/Combined) | Engine | Transmission |
|---|---|---|---|
| Auto | 14/19/16 | 4.2L 6cyl | Automatic 4-spd |
| Auto | 13/17/15 | 5.3L 8cyl | Automatic 4-spd |
| Auto | 13/18/15 | 4.2L 6cyl | Automatic 4-spd |
| Auto | 14/18/16 | 5.3L 8cyl | Automatic 4-spd |
Annual Fuel Cost
Based on EPA estimates, the 2004 Chevrolet TrailBlazer Ext costs approximately $2,850 per year in fuel. This assumes 15,000 miles driven annually and current fuel prices.
